About the role

Tutors aurally handicapped students on a one-to-one or small-group basis to remedy academic deficiencies to meet goals and objectives of Individual Education Plans.

Responsibilities

  • Assists in administering diagnostic and achievement tests to pupils.
  • Participates in conferences to establish Individual Educational Plans for identified students.
  • Compiles instructional materials to help meet the goals and objectives of Individual Education Plans.
  • Communicates with teachers and resource specialists regarding students' progress and needs.
  • Develops tutoring schedules and interpreting services consistent with the daily school schedules and special activities.
  • Maintains a log and daily records of student attendance, attitude, health, performance and progress.
  • Explains the purpose and goals of the tutorial program to teachers.
  • Attends and participates in professional development sessions.
  • Assists with student toileting.

Qualifications

  • Using Signing Exact English and/or American Sign Language.
  • Experience tutoring persons with disabilities.
  • -High school graduation or the equivalent.
  • -Completion of at least 48 semester units (or 72 quarter units) at the college level.
  • -OR- Possession of an Associate's or higher level degree.
  • -OR- Pass assessment that demonstrates knowledge of and the ability to assist in teaching reading, writing, and mathematics.
